Low-Calorie Baked Beans
Hearty baked beans are infused with a blend of smoky bacon, paprika, and sweet brown sugar for a flavorful side dish.

Instructions
-
Preheat oven to 375 F and coat an 8x8-inch baking pan with cooking spray.
-
In a large skillet, cook turkey bacon over medium-high heat for 5-6 minutes until crisp; crumble and set aside.
-
Add onion to the same skillet and cook over medium heat for 3-4 minutes until translucent.
-
Turn off heat, then stir in the crumbled bacon, catsup, brown sugar, mustard, Worcestershire sauce, paprika, and beans into the skillet.
-
Pour the mixture into the prepared baking pan and cover with foil.
-
Bake for 20 minutes, then serve.
